  4. iLo Technologies -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/ILo_Technologies

    iLo Technologies. Launched in 2004, iLo technologies is a Wal-Mart consumer electronics house brand. [1] Wal-Mart sells many low cost, entry-level consumer electronics products under the iLo name in stores and on Walmart.com. As with many house brands, no single company manufactures all iLo products.

  9. Durabrand -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Durabrand

    Introduction. Durabrand was first started in early 1999 as a brand only made for Wal-Mart stores as a generic brand for electronics, but has grown to be available near-internationally (due to Wal-Mart's global reach). Wal-Mart Germany was the first country to introduce the private label with a lineup in Consumer Electronics.
